Configuration Byte 0Eh, Diagnostic Status
Default Value = 00h
This byte contains diagnostic status data.
Configuration Byte 0Fh, System Reset Code
Default Value = 00h
This byte contains the system reset code.
Configuration Byte 10h, Diskette Drive Type
Bit
Function
7..4
Primary (Drive A) Diskette Drive Type
3..0
Secondary (Drive B) Diskette Drive Type
Valid values for bits <7..4> and bits <3..0>:
0000 = Not installed
0001 = 360-KB drive
0010 = 1.2-MB drive
0011 = 720-KB drive
0100 = 1.44-MB/1.25-MB drive
0110 = 2.88-MB drive
(all other values reserved)
Configuration Byte 12h, Hard Drive Type
Bit
Function
7..4
Primary Controller 1, Hard Drive 1 Type:
0000 = none
0001 = Type 1
0010 = Type 2
0011 = Type 3
0100 = Type 4
0101 = Type 5
0110 = Type 6
0111 = Type 7
3..0
Primary Controller 1, Hard Drive 2 Type:
0000 = none
0001 = Type 1
0010 = Type 2
0011 = Type 3
0100 = Type 4
0101 = Type 5
0110 = Type 6
0111 = Type 7
1000 = Type 8
1001 = Type 9
1010 = Type 10
1011 = Type 11
1100 = Type 12
1101 = Type 13
1110 = Type 14
1111 = other (use bytes 19h)
1000 = Type 8
1001 = Type 9
1010 = Type 10
1011 = Type 11
1100 = Type 12
1101 = Type 13
1110 = Type 14
1111 = other (use bytes 1Ah)
